Platzhalter Bild

Hybrid Software Architect na Lenovo

Lenovo · Morrisville, Estados Unidos Da América · Hybrid

Candidatar-se agora
About the Role We’re looking for a mid-level Software Architect to help shape the architecture behind Lenovo’s next generation of connected smart devices. You’ll play a key role in designing scalable, secure, and low-latency systems that power seamless experiences across hardware and software—bridging cloud, mobile, and embedded platforms. This is a hands-on architecture role where you’ll partner across disciplines, drive technical strategy, and ensure our smart ecosystem continues to lead in performance, reliability, and innovation. Responsibilities:  Design Scalable Connectivity Architectures: Lead the design of software systems that enable secure, high-performance communication between Lenovo smart devices. Drive Device Orchestration Strategies: Define how devices interact, sync, and respond to each other—ensuring real-time performance, reliability, and interoperability. Collaborate Across Teams: Work closely with firmware, hardware, mobile, and cloud engineering teams to build a unified end-to-end architecture. Champion the Right Technologies: Identify and advocate for protocols, tools, and frameworks best suited for robust and secure device communication. Lead with Technical Depth: Guide technical design discussions, conduct architecture reviews, and mentor engineers across teams. Contribute to Roadmaps & Innovation: Help shape Lenovo’s long-term technology roadmap through prototyping, R&D collaboration, and continuous exploration of what’s next. Required Qualifications:  4+ years of experience in software architecture, preferably in IoT, smart devices, or edge computing environments Strong understanding of communication protocols (e.g., MQTT, BLE, Thread, Zigbee), distributed systems, and low-latency networking Preferred Qualifications:  Experience integrating across embedded systems, cloud infrastructure, and mobile platforms Collaborative mindset and experience working across hardware-software boundaries Clear communication skills and the ability to translate complex systems into actionable plans Familiarity with Android or Linux-based device stacks Prior experience in consumer electronics or connected home devices
Candidatar-se agora

Outros empregos